什么软件可以打开编程文件
-
要打开编程文件,可以使用多种软件。以下是几种常用的软件:
-
文本编辑器:许多编程文件是以纯文本格式保存的,如源代码文件。在这种情况下,可以使用文本编辑器来打开它们。常见的文本编辑器包括Sublime Text、Notepad++、Atom等。这些文本编辑器提供了高亮显示、语法检查等功能,使编程文件易于阅读和编辑。
-
集成开发环境(IDE):IDE是专门用于编程的软件,它集成了多种工具,如代码编辑器、编译器、调试器等。IDE提供了更多的功能和便利性,适合开发大型项目。常见的编程语言都有相应的IDE,如Visual Studio、Eclipse、NetBeans等。
-
Jupyter Notebook:对于Python编程文件,Jupyter Notebook是一种流行的选择。它可以将代码、文本、图像等内容整合到一个交互式环境中,使文件更具可读性和可视化效果。Jupyter Notebook通常用于数据分析、机器学习等领域。
-
虚拟机/容器:有些编程文件可能需要在特定的运行环境中才能正确打开和运行。虚拟机和容器可以提供独立的运行环境,如虚拟机软件VMware、VirtualBox,以及容器引擎Docker等。
总之,要打开编程文件,需要根据文件的类型和需要选择合适的软件。根据个人的喜好和使用场景选择最适合自己的软件是最重要的。
1年前 -
-
有许多不同的软件可以打开编程文件,具体取决于文件的类型和编程语言。以下是一些常见的可以打开编程文件的软件:
-
文本编辑器:文本编辑器是最常用的打开编程文件的软件。它们允许用户直接查看和编辑文本文件,如代码文件。一些常见的文本编辑器包括NotePad++、Sublime Text、Atom和Visual Studio Code。这些编辑器通常提供了代码高亮、语法检查和代码折叠等功能,以便开发者更方便地编写和阅读代码。
-
集成开发环境(IDE):IDE是一种更高级的软件,提供了更多关于代码开发和调试的功能。每种编程语言通常都有自己的IDE。例如,Java开发者可以使用Eclipse、IntelliJ IDEA或NetBeans等软件打开和编辑Java文件;Python开发者可以使用PyCharm或Spyder等软件打开和编辑Python文件。IDE通常包括代码编辑器、编译器、调试器和其他与开发相关的工具。
-
命令行界面:对于一些命令行编程语言,如C++和Python,可以使用命令行界面打开和运行代码文件。用户只需在终端中输入相应的命令,就可以执行代码文件。例如,使用g++命令可以将C++源代码文件编译为可执行文件,并在命令行中运行。
-
虚拟机或解释器:某些编程语言需要在特定的虚拟机或解释器中运行。例如,Java需要Java虚拟机(JVM)来解释和执行Java代码。因此,打开和运行Java文件通常需要Java开发工具包(JDK)和JVM。同样,Python文件需要在Python解释器中运行。用户可以下载和安装相应的虚拟机或解释器,并使用其所提供的工具打开和运行代码文件。
-
集成的开发环境(IDE):有些集成开发环境(IDE)还提供了对特定编程语言的内置编译器和解释器。例如,MATLAB是一种数值计算和编程语言,具有自己的IDE。MATLAB的IDE集成了MATLAB编程语言的编辑器、编译器和解释器。用户可以使用MATLAB的IDE打开和运行MATLAB文件,并进行数值计算和数据分析。
总之,具体使用哪种软件打开编程文件取决于文件的类型和编程语言。常见的选择包括文本编辑器、集成开发环境、命令行界面和特定的虚拟机或解释器。
1年前 -
-
软件的选择取决于所要打开的编程文件的类型。根据不同类型的编程文件,可以使用不同的软件来打开和编辑。
- 文本编辑器
文本编辑器是一种能够打开和编辑纯文本文件的软件,它们通常是最常用的打开编程文件的工具。常见的文本编辑器包括:
- Windows记事本:Windows操作系统自带的文本编辑器,可以简单地打开和编辑文本文件,但功能较为有限。
- Sublime Text:功能丰富的跨平台文本编辑器,支持多种编程语言,拥有高亮显示、代码折叠、自动补全等功能。
- Visual Studio Code:由微软开发的免费文本编辑器,对多种编程语言提供了丰富的插件支持,具有调试功能和集成终端等特点。
- Atom:由GitHub开发的免费文本编辑器,拥有丰富的插件生态系统,可以定制化编辑器风格和功能。
- 集成开发环境(IDE)
集成开发环境是一种集成了多个工具和功能的软件,通常用于开发和调试程序。IDE能够提供代码编辑器、编译器、调试器等一系列功能,可以方便地进行编程工作。以下是几个常用的IDE:
- Eclipse:一款Java开发的IDE,支持多种编程语言,具有强大的插件和项目管理能力。
- Visual Studio:由微软开发的IDE,主要用于开发Windows应用程序,支持多种编程语言如C++、C#等。
- Xcode:针对苹果开发的IDE,用于开发iOS和macOS应用程序。
- Android Studio:针对安卓开发的IDE,用于开发Android应用程序。
- 特定语言的编辑器
针对特定的编程语言,有一些专用的编辑器可以提供更好的语法高亮、代码自动补全等功能。例如:
- MATLAB:用于科学计算和工程仿真的语言,可以使用MATLAB编辑器打开和编辑MATLAB代码文件。
- RStudio:用于R语言的集成开发环境,可以提供R语言的调试和可视化功能。
- PyCharm:专门用于Python开发的IDE,提供了强大的集成开发环境和调试功能。
总之,根据所要打开的编程文件类型和个人喜好,可以选择合适的文本编辑器或集成开发环境来进行编程工作。
1年前 - 文本编辑器